A negative growth rate means it is decreasing. The two main factors affecting population growth are the birth rate (b) and death rate (d). The growth of the population is decreasing.
- Growth rate of the population depends upon:-
-Birth rate
-Death rate
-Immigration
-Emigration
What is emigration?
- Movement of organism from its residing place to another place.
- This generally happen because of certain factors like not suitable habitat, occupation, food, etc.
